txnation.jpgA pair of Lamar graduates are ready to be teammates again, this time for a college all-star game. SMU standout Ben Poynter will be joined by Louisiana-Monroe's Adam Hill on the Lone Star State offensive line in the Texas vs. The Nation Bowl on Saturday, Feb. 2, 2008. The game, which pits top collegiate seniors who went to high school or college in Texas against top seniors from around the nation, will be held at Sun Bowl Stadium.

Steele Commits to Colorado State
Written by Chris Mycoskie   
Wednesday, 23 January 2008
colorado_st.gifLamar cornerback Byron Steele verbally committed to attend Colorado State University, where he'll play football for the Rams of the Mountain West Conference. The 6'4", 210 pound Steele earned first team all-district honors following his senior season with the Vikings.
 
Spence Commits to Louisiana Tech
Written by FOX News Louisiana   
Monday, 17 December 2007
louisiana_tech.gifLamar defensive end and tight end Chandler Spence has given his verbal commitment to Louisiana Tech University. He chose Tech over Air Force, Virginia and Central Florida among others.
